Château de Manvieux

The Château de Manvieu is a medieval castle located in Manvieux, France.

Overview

This fortified structure has played a significant role in the region's history and continues to be an important cultural landmark.

History

  • The construction of the Château de Manvieu dates back to the 12th century, with its primary purpose being as a stronghold for local lords.
  • Over the centuries, the castle has undergone various transformations and expansions, reflecting the changing needs of its occupants.

Architecture

The castle's architecture is characterized by its medieval design, featuring a mix of stone and brick construction.

  • The layout consists of a central keep surrounded by outer walls, with several towers and battlements.
  • The building's style is typical of the Norman period, with influences from other European architectural traditions.

Layout

The castle's interior features a series of corridors, chambers, and great halls, designed to accommodate the needs of its occupants.

  • The keep, the chapel, and the lord's quarters are notable rooms within the castle.

Notable Features

  • The castle's walls are adorned with intricate stone carvings and ornate doorways.
  • A large moat surrounds the structure, adding to its defensive capabilities.
  • The keep features a distinctive tower that offers panoramic views of the surrounding countryside.

Historical Significance

The Château de Manvieu has played a significant role in regional history, serving as a stronghold for local lords and a center of power during times of conflict.

The castle has also been associated with several notable events, including battles and sieges.

Current Status and Use

Today, the Château de Manvieux is owned by the French state and serves as a museum, open to the public for guided tours.

Visitors can explore the castle's rooms, gardens, and surrounding grounds, gaining insight into its rich history and cultural significance.

Heritage Status

The Château de Manvieu has been designated as a Monument Historique by the French government, recognizing its importance as a cultural and historical landmark.
